Wendy Asiamah Addo, popularly known as Wendy Shay, donated teaching and learning materials to students at the Weija Presbyterian Primary and Junior High School in the Greater Accra Region on Monday, November 20, 2023, through her organization Shay Foundation.
Branded exercise books, freshly made school uniforms, detergents, and refreshing drinking water were among the kind donations.

This charitable deed, which honored International Children’s Day, demonstrates Wendy Shay’s commitment to encouraging student access to critical educational resources.

Speaking to the school’s kids and staff, the ‘Bedroom Commando’ singer stated, “Shay Foundation is a nonprofit organisation that is committed to seeing to the welfare of both young and old. The organisation aims to support the educational needs of the community. Our main mission is to provide equitable access to quality education for underserved communities. It’s sad to see people drop out of school because they do not have the proper materials. Education is the key to the future, and we must do everything possible to make sure that every child has access.”

The acclaimed singer welcomed kindred spirits with open arms, pushing them to band together and make a lasting effect on the foundation’s noble endeavor.
Wendy Shay ensured that, in addition to educational contributions, entertainment played a role in the donation ceremony, exciting students with live performances of some of her favorites.
For the past three years, the Shay Foundation has been pursuing these humanitarian endeavors with zeal.
